About the course
Playing along the Iron river, this picturesque course plays through an old iron mine. The short tees providing a fun and challenging round for players of all skill and the longs to give a challenge to those confident in their arm and play. We are in the process of reclaiming the course from nature with a small team of volunteers so please bear with us during this time.
18 holes
concrete Tees
Mach III Targets
Mixed use
Established in 2010

How do I get to The Tailings?
How do I get to The Tailings?
You can get directions to The Tailings by clicking Get Directions, which will open your device's map application with the disc golf course location. The disc golf course is located at 46.089, -88.638 in Iron River, Michigan.
Do I need to pay to play disc golf at The Tailings?
Do I need to pay to play disc golf at The Tailings?
The Tailings is free to play! Just show up and enjoy the disc golf course.
What is the difficulty and length of The Tailings?
What is the difficulty and length of The Tailings?
The Tailings has 18 disc golf holes and has a difficulty rating of "Moderate". The typical disc golf round at The Tailings takes about 2 hours and covers approximately 2.1 miles (3.4 km).
